If a restful holiday is part of your travel plans, Ballyholme Beach might be the perfect place to visit during your trip to Bangor. While you're in the area, stroll along the marina.
Just east of Belfast, the small seaside town of Bangor in County Down is a quiet place to get away, close to the Northern Irish capital. The picturesque Castle Park at Bangor’s centre makes an ideal spot for a tranquil moment of reflection.
